Spend some time in the junkyard. The front skid is hard to find, but the transfer case skid and fuel tank skid can be swapped from a ZJ which are much more common. I'd recommend the ZJ transfer case skid for anyone with a 242, the stock 231 skid plate will not clear the 242. You'll need to drill three holes to make it fit - two in the crossmember, one in the frame rail. I used nutserts to install it, just like was done at the factory.
The ZJ gas tank skid swap is super common. Do a search, no drilling into the Jeep, just the skid.
